Stuffed Pointed Pepper

These Stuffed Chili Peppers are a mouthwatering delight, bursting with savory flavors and a perfect balance of spice. Fresh chili peppers are generously filled with a rich meat mixture blended with aromatic ginger, scallions, and water caltrop for a unique texture. The filling is seasoned to perfection with oyster sauce, soy sauce, cooking wine, and cornstarch, ensuring every bite is juicy and flavorful. Pan-fried until golden brown, the peppers develop a crisp exterior while staying tender inside. Simmered in a savory sauce until perfectly soft, this dish is a harmony of textures and tastes. Whether served as an appetizer or main course, these stuffed peppers are sure to impress with their bold, umami-packed profile. Instructions

0% Complete
1
Step 1
Grind the ginger and scallions, filter them with clean water to get the ginger and scallion water. Mash the water caltrop into small particles, add them to the meat filling, and mix well with oyster sauce, soy sauce, cooking wine, and cornstarch.
Step 1
2
Step 2
Cut off the stem of the chili peppers and remove the seeds.
Step 2
3
Step 3
Stuff the meat filling into the chili peppers, making sure to fill them tightly.
Step 3
4
Step 4
Heat a pan with oil over medium heat, add the stuffed chili peppers and fry until the surface is golden brown.
Step 4
5
Step 5
Add water and seasonings, and cook until the chili peppers are tender, then reduce the sauce and serve.
Step 5
